Jalapeno poppers - sliced lengthwise, filled with hot Italian sausage mixed with sour cream, then wrapped with a slice of bacon. In the oven for a bit, and then........food coma.

Apps - Deviled eggs, seven layer dip, Corned beef pickle wraps with cream cheese (pinwheels as I call them)
Main- 10 pounds of pulled pork. We have a flat top grill that we bring and make grilled cheese pulled pork sandwiches. I may need to change my shirt from the drool just talking about it.
desert - scotcheroos . nothing more
